Industrial Door Operating Instructions
Roller Shutter Door
A. Self Coiling (Push Up)
1. TO OPEN: Release all locking mechanisms on
the bottom rail, on the side, and elsewhere – lift
the door curtain upwards in a controlled manner,
to its full height, using a hook and pole where
provided.
2. TO CLOSE: Pull on the bottom rail, using hook
and pole where provided, and push door curtain
down to the fully closed position, and re-engage
locking mechanisms.
B. Hand Chain Operated
1. TO OPEN: Release hand chain from lockable
holder, release any additional locking
mechanisms, pull downward on the required hand
chain, in a controlled manner, until curtain is fully
open, replace hand chain into lockable position
and secure.
2. TO CLOSE: Release hand chain from lockable
holder, pull downward on hand chain, in a
controlled manner until door curtain is fully
closed, replace hand chain into lockable holder.
3. Any Wicket gate installation MUST be hinged completely out of the
way prior to operating the door curtain.
Please note that the design of the counter balance
springs will mean that the curtain will rise at the bottom,
will be a little heavier to lift in the middle section, and
will rise to the top -DO NOT ALLOW THE DOOR TO
SLAM UPWARDS AGAINST THE STOPS.

C. Electrically Operated
1. TO OPEN: Press “Open” button on the
central control station. The door curtain will
automatically stop at the full opening height –
unless the “Stop” button is pressed.
2. TO CLOSE: Press “Close” button on the
central control station. The door curtain will
automatically stop when fully closed, or when the
button is released.
3. TO STOP: Press the red “Stop” button.
4. IN THE EVENT OF A POWER FAILURE:
The motor is fitted with an emergency hand chain
or crank mechanism access to the motor will be
required. Lift hand chain or crank into position
and operate manually. Operation will be very
slow – when power is reinstated, the door will
not operate electrically until hand chain or
crank has been removed.

Fire Roller Shutter Operating Instructions
D. Self Coiling (Push Up) Fire Shutter
Designed to close in the event of a fire. Not designed to be used on
a regular basis, if however, the curtain is lowered for inspection
or other purposes, it will be difficult to lift up refer to section “A”
E. Hand Chain Operated Fire Shutter
Designed to close in the event of a fire. Not designed to be used on
a regular basis, if however, the curtain is lowered for inspection
or other purposes, it will be difficult to lift up refer to section “A”
F. Electrically Operated Fire Shutters
Designed to close in the event of a fire – for operational instructions,
refer to Section “C”
SPECIAL NOTE :
It is now a legal requirement that ALL Fire Shutters and Electrically
Operated Roller Shutters SHALL be subject to suitable maintenance and be
maintained in an efficient state.

Sliding Folding Door Operating Instructions
J. Manual Operation
1. TO OPEN: Release any locking mechanisms, and slide door fully
open, using the handles fixed to the leading edges.
2. TO CLOSE: Pull on handles attached to the leading edge until in
the closed position, then engage any locking
mechanisms.

Sliding Folding Door Operating Instructions (cont).
K. Electrically Operated
1. TO OPEN: Press “Open” button on central control station,
the door will automatically stop when fully open.
2. TO CLOSE: Press “Close” button on central control station,
the door will automatically stop when fully
closed, or when button is released.
3. IN THE EVENT OF A POWER FAILURE:
Power failure : release mechanism on leading door edge to
disengage drive chain, then use as section “J”. When power is
re-instated, re-engage drive mechanism.
Note: A safety clutch mechanism is fitted to all
electrically operated doors of this type, which is
activated when the door strikes an obstruction.
General Note: BGID does not recommend fitting locking
devises to electrically operated doors. If locking must be
fitted, then it MUST be released prior to operating the
door or serious damage to the door / motor may occur.

Mel-Tec type 4FMB Roller Shutters
The shutter curtain is fitted to a steel roller. This roller revolves to wind up
or wind down the shutter curtain.
One end of the roller is fitted with an electric motor, whilst the other end of
the roller is fitted with a safety brake.
MOTOR:
The motor is controlled by a switch. The switch system should be of the
“hold to run” type.
ROLLER SHUTTER SPECIFICATION:
The roller shutter curtain is manufactured from 44 mm. x 9 mm. foam filled
aluminium profile.
Extruded aluminium side guides with weather seals - size
53 mm. x 22 mm.
Roller assembly manufactured from steel. Fitted with a single phase
230/250 volt tubular motor. The roller is fitted with auto locking elements to
hold the shutter curtain in the closed and locked position. The tubular
motor incorporates adjustable limit switches. These limits are set so that
the motor is switched off when the shutter is in either the open (up) or
closed (down) position.
Box assembly manufactured from powder coated roll formed aluminium
with powder coated cast aluminium box ends. The box is constructed so
that the cover can be easily removed for servicing. Powder coat paint
finish – white.
USE:
Window shutters.
ELECTRICAL CONNECTIONS:
The tubular motor has a 4 core cable – Earth & Neutral with feeds for each
direction of travel. The use of latching switches, whereby the power is
constantly connected to the shutter motor is NOT recommended.

MAINTENANCE:
It is STRONGLY recommended that a Preventative Maintenance Contract
be arranged with a competent shutter maintenance company - BGID offer
such maintenance contracts.
The shutter guides should be kept clean and free from any materials that
might jamb the shutter curtain. All electrical components should be
checked on a regular basis – the operation of the safety brake should also
be checked on a regular basis.

Warning : All types of Roller Shutter and
Sectional Overhead Doors are fitted with
counter balance spring mechanisms, which
are under considerable tension. Any
adjustment or repair MUST only be carried
out by trained and qualified BGID
installation engineers.

GENERAL
1. Only use opening & closing equipment supplied with the door
2. Keep opening clear of any obstacles when operating the door
3. DO NOT try to operate a damaged door – we recommend that you call BGID
Service Department, who will advise the best course of action
4. DO NOT lean obstacles against the door
5. Work carried out on electrical control equipment MUST be by a competent
electrician who MUST ensure the equipment is isolated prior to commencing any
work. BGID have fully trained electrical staff.
GENERAL CLEANING
Every month clean shutters down using a mild detergent i.e. warm soapy water.
Clean dust and dirt from inside facings and from guides. Lubricate moving parts.

MAINTENANCE
Health & Safety Welfare Regulations 1992 now applies to all Work Places
from 1st. January 1996
Industrial Doors now have to comply with these regulations as from 1st.
January 1996
a. by door user -door operation is working freely and there is no
visible damage to the door.
b. by Approved Industrial Door Engineers – commonly twice
per annum.
1. secure any loose fastenings
2. fully inspect all mechanical points
3. adjust lock if required
4. apply lubricants to all relevant parts
5. check electrics i.e. control station, gearbox and limits
6. fire doors only – carry out a mechanical “drop” test to
ensure door closes in the event of a fire
7. sliding folding doors – clean out bottom track
BGID provide a written report after each service visit.
